Well designed, easy to use and can be connected to your PC for data analysis
I was concerned with the price being so reasonable, but this is a well made and functional unit. easy to use, and capable of a wide range of measurements, it is easily able to read normal background radiation without trouble, but can also read much higher fields. Pictured is a reading while flying at altitude - this number comports fully with established rates one should expect at altitude. The programming API is open and easy enough to use, but not necessary for most folks. Battery life is ridiculous long, it will run for days. All in all, this is a fantastic value for anyone with a general interest in understanding the radiation fields they live in. it wont detect radon - that is an alpha particle and this meter reads beta and gamma.

It's a dependable workhorse.
The 500+ is a great all around unit with a medium sensitivity it's well balanced and won't easily overload. It has two tubes one that is fairly high sensitivity and one that can handle massive readings that would long overload the first tube. You could replace the later tube for a different tube if you so choose. The construction is good, solid, and light. It's styling is a tad conspicuous if you were say trying to take covert readings without drawing attention I hope a GQ GMC-500-Slim is in the works. The battery life is about 7days at background and 4-5 days with occasional high loads like a few feistaware dose measurements or a Cs calibration source stress test. It seams reasonably accurate and measures in the ball park uSv/hr as more expensive units. A beta shield would be another requested improvement but thats picky and you could easily fabricate an aluminum case to do the same. The interface is not as stylish as as some of the other brands how ever it really wins brownie points for being versital. The module they are based on can have functionality added on the fly and can be reprogrammed for use with alt tubes. If you for instance use this for lab work you could set a custom macro to take a timed reading every 4hrs report them to a custom server and monitor them at home.
